† These instructions have an identical set of addressing modes, which
are encoded for brevity. The first opcode nibble is found in the instruction
set table above. The second nibble is expressed symbolically by a ‘[ ]’
in this table, and its value is found in the following table to the left of the
applicable addressing mode pair.
For example, the opcode of an ADC instruction using the addressing
modes r (destination) and Ir (source) is 13.
